Frequently asked questions

What is the name of Teignmouth's airport?
If you’re arriving by plane, you won’t have to ponder too long which airport to choose. Teignmouth has just one – Exeter Intl. Airport (EXT).
How far is Exeter Intl. Airport (EXT) from central Teignmouth?
Exeter Intl. Airport (EXT) is 13 mi from central Teignmouth, so expect a bit of a commute into the heart of the city.
What airport is best to fly into Teignmouth?
With just one main airport servicing Teignmouth, it won’t take much time to find the best flight. You’ll be jetting off to Exeter Intl. Airport, which is located around 13 mi from the downtown area.
How many airlines fly to Teignmouth?
There are 7 airlines that fly into Teignmouth from 14 worldwide airports.
Which airlines fly to Teignmouth?
Blue Islands operates the majority of the flights to Teignmouth. Catching a Blue Islands flight from St. Peter is the preferred way to get there.
How many nonstop flights are there to Teignmouth?
Organising an exciting Teignmouth adventure is easy when there are 45 direct flights each week to pick from.
Where are the most popular flights to Teignmouth departing from?
Travellers frequently jet off from Edinburgh, Belfast and Dublin airports when heading to Teignmouth.
How long is the flight to Teignmouth Airport?
If it’s St. Peter you’re departing, you’ll be midair for around 45 minutes before you arrive in Teignmouth. Tarmac to tarmac from Hugh Town typically takes 1 hour and from Tresco, the average flight time is 1 hour.

How to survive the flight to Teignmouth?
No matter where you’re coming from, flying can be a seamless experience if you prepare well enough. Take a peek at these handy hints that will help get your Teignmouth escape started on the right note.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• It’s simple — first, pack in your passport, official ID, credit cards and medications. Next, you’ll need some entertainment to while away the time. A thrilling novel and a laptop filled with your favourite movies are some terrific options. If you plan to catch up on some sleep, a quality neck pillow and a pair of noise-cancelling headphones will also come in handy. Finally, find room for a few toiletry items so you’ll hop off the plane feeling fresh and ready to go.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of banned items differs between airlines, the general rule of thumb is nothing sharp, flammable or explosive. This includes things like screwdrivers, drills, spray paint and flares. Sports equipment like ski poles, and objects that could harm passengers, such as swords and batons, aren’t allowed in the cabin either.

What to wear on a flight:

  • The main aim is to feel as comfortable as you can. Layer up in breathable clothing and bring a sweater in case you get cold. Go for a pair of well-fitting, flat shoes as your feet may swell a little during the journey. Leave the high heels and heavy boots in your main luggage.
  • Unfortunately, a risk of long flights is developing deep vein thrombosis (DVT), a blood clotting condition caused by extended periods of inactivity. To prevent this, take every opportunity to wander around the cabin. Compression socks and tights are also a great idea to help minimize this risk.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Teignmouth?
It’s simple — be prepared. We’ve compiled some handy tips and tricks for a fuss-free trip through airport security. Look out Teignmouth, here you come:

  • Your ID and travel documents will need to be inspected by airport security personnel. Have them easily accessible so you don’t hold up the line.
  • Time to strip down. Well sort of. Your belt, coat, keys and other contents of your pockets, like coins, will be required to go through the X-ray machine. Make the whole process easier by removing them before your turn.
  • All your electronic devices, including your phone and laptop, must also be scanned.
  • Want to bring along your favourite perfume or cologne? As long as it’s in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and it’s stored in a zip-lock bag, you can keep it with you in your carry-on bag.
  • There’s a possibility that you’ll be asked to take your shoes off to be X-rayed, so wearing slip-on shoes is always a good idea.
  • Pocket knives and other sharp items can’t be taken on board. They’ll be confiscated at security, so put them in your checked baggage.
